Api iConta
iConta
  1. Facturas
  • Introducción
  • Persona
    • Estándar Persona
    • Consultar Persona
      POST
    • Guardar Persona
      POST
    • Listar Personas
      POST
    • Modificar Persona
      POST
  • Cotización
    • Estandar Unidad Tiempo
    • Fuentes de Venta
      • Consultar Fuentes de Venta
    • Detalle Cotización
      POST
    • Lista Cotización
      POST
    • Generar Cotización
      POST
    • Anular Cotización
      POST
    • Lista Campo Adicional Cotización
      POST
  • Facturas
    • Forma Pago
      • Listar Forma Pago
    • Tipo Comprobante
      • Lista Tipo Comprobante
    • Anular Factura
      POST
    • Consultar Forma Pago
      POST
    • Generar Factura
      POST
    • Enviar Factura SRI
      POST
    • Listar Estado Factura
      POST
  • Guía de Remisión
    • Genera Guía de Remisión
      POST
    • Anular Guía de Remisión
      POST
    • Consultar Guía de Remisión
      POST
  • Compras
    • Generar Compra
      POST
    • Listar Compras
      POST
    • Detalle Compra
      POST
  • Bancos
    • Listar Chequera
    • Listar Lotes/Tarjetas
  • Inventario
    • Estandar Tipo Movimiento Inventario
    • Bodega
      • Listar Bodega
    • Producto
      • Tipo Producto
        • Listar Tipo Producto
        • Guarda Tipo Producto
      • Unidad
        • Lista Unidad
      • Categoria
        • Listar Categoria
        • Guarda Categoria
        • Guardar Categoría con Cuentas Contables por Defecto
      • Marca
        • Listar Marca
        • Guarda Marca
      • Impuestos
        • Lista Impuestos Agregado
        • Lista Impuesto Consumo Especial
      • Detalle Producto
      • Listar Producto
      • Generar Producto
      • Listar Producto Precio
      • Punto Emisión Producto
    • Listar Movimiento Inventario
    • Generar Movimiento Inventario
  • Centro de Costos
    • Generar Centro de Costo
    • Listar Centros de Costo
    • Modificar Centro de Costo
  • Cobros / Pagos
    • Estandar Cobros/Pagos
    • Anular Cobro/Pago
    • Detalle Documento
    • Generar Cobro
    • Generar Pago
    • Listar Documentos
  • Contable
    • Consultar Contable
  • Nota de Crédito
    • Consulta Factura para Aplicar Nota de Crédito
    • Generar Nota de Crédito
    • Anular Nota de Crédito
    • Envio Nota de Crédito al SRI
    • Consultar Estado Nota de Crédito
  1. Facturas

Generar Factura

POST
api/external/factura/genera
Este servicio permite generar una nueva factura, ya sea electrónica o manual, dentro del sistema. La factura es un documento esencial para registrar transacciones comerciales, detallando la compra o venta de productos o servicios. Dependiendo de las necesidades del usuario o la normativa legal vigente.

Solicitud

Autorización
Proporciona tu token bearer en el encabezado
Authorization
al realizar solicitudes a recursos protegidos.
Ejemplo:
Authorization: Bearer ********************
Parámetros del Body application/jsonRequerido

Ejemplo
   {
            "id_sistema": "00128347",
            "fecha_emision": "19/03/2022",
            "fecha_vencimiento": "19/03/2022",
            "es_electronica": true,
            "establecimiento": "001",
            "punto_emision": "001",
            "secuencia": "000000000",
            "autorizacion": "0123456789",
            "cliente" : {
                "ruc": "1700000000001",
                "cedula": "1700000000",
                "pasaporte": "PAST001254",
                "razon_social": "EMPRESA DE PRUEBA",
                "telefono": "0980000000",
                "direccion": "Direccion del cliente",
                "email": "test@iconta.ec"
            },
            "descripcion": "Detalle de la factura a generar",
            "detalles":[{
                "codigo_producto": "CODTEST01",
                "cantidad": "5.00",
                "valor_unitario": "12.350000",
                "porcentaje_descuento": "10.00",
                "aplica_porcentaje_servicio": false,
                "iva_aplicado": "12",
                "detalle": "Por prueba producto 1",
                "id_bodega": 0,
                "id_centro_costo": 0
                },
            {
                "codigo_producto": "CODTEST02", 
                "verifica_crea_producto": true,
                "nombre_producto": "PRODUCTO DE PRUEBA",
                "id_categoria_producto": 0,
                "id_tipo_producto": 0,
                "id_marca_producto": 0,
                "codigo_unidad_producto": "U",
                "cantidad": "1.00",
                "valor_unitario": "1245.350000",
                "porcentaje_descuento": "0.00",
                "aplica_porcentaje_servicio": false,
                "iva_aplicado": "12",
                "detalle": "Por prueba producto 2",
                "id_bodega": 0,
                "id_centro_costo": 0
                }
            ], 
            "pagos": [
                {
                "codigo_forma_pago": "01-1111",
                "documento": "0000000",
                "id_centro_costo": 0,
                "valor": "1457.04"
                }
            ]
    }
  

Respuestas

🟢200Éxito
application/json
Body

Ejemplo
{
    "id_factura": 1,
    "es_electronica": true,
    "numero_comprobante": "002-001-000000753",
    "sF_ExisteError": false,
    "sF_Error": null
}
Anterior
Consultar Forma Pago
Siguiente
Enviar Factura SRI
Built with